Sessions: Engage & Explore: Creative Ideas in Lessons & Learning
- MATH STANDARDS & PRACTICES 6th grade Domain: Ratios and Proportional Relationships-Understand ratio concepts and use ratio reasoning to solve problems.
- WHAT WILL ATTENDEES GAIN? Attendees will gain a vision of how ratios and proportions can be taught through manipulatives and inquiry based learning.
- BEYOND "STAND & DELIVER" This is not a presentation on how to learn math. This is a math experience where learning happens through interactions and discussions among the attendees.
